Four reasons why you should level up in dungeons in World of Warcraft

Dungeon leveling became a viable method of power leveling when Dungeon Finder was introduced with World of Warcraft patch 3.3. Now you can easily find groups to run dungeons no matter what time of day it is. When you queue up for a dungeon, you will be asked if you are a DPS, Tank, or Heal.

Let’s face it, solo missions can get boring sometimes. Dungeon leveling makes playing WoW more fun because you can interact with other players, not only from your server but from other realms as well. You will learn the mechanics of playing in a group that will help you in the future as a raider.

Before the dungeon finder tool was released, most players didn’t even set foot in a dungeon until they reached max level. This is why most level 80 characters don’t know their roles in a party. Instance leveling gives you a chance to practice being in a party through lower level dungeons.

More people enjoy dungeon leveling because you get more experience points than leveling through solo quests. Your downtime is kept to a minimum when you’re inside an instance. The mentality of the players inside a dungeon is to kill, kill, kill. That means your party will get a high average kill per section and spend less time running around aimlessly.

Dungeon quests are important when you are leveling dungeons. Blizzard designed World of Warcraft so that dungeon quest rewards are higher than regular quests. Dungeon quests grant double experience points compared to normal quests. That means you need to do twice as many solo quests to get the same amount of XP that you can get from dungeon quests.

Dungeon leveling also gives you a chance to get better equipment for your character. Boss drops are far superior to the gear you can get outside of the instance. Better gear makes your character more powerful and makes your leveling life so much easier.

In that sense, dungeon quest rewards are of higher quality than individual quest rewards. Dungeon quests give you blue items that are better than the green ones from individual quests. Also, the rewards are the best equipment available for your current level.

Dungeon leveling is also a new way to earn more gold in World of Warcraft. Because your party kills non-stop within the instance, you also earn more gold per second. Instance farming takes on a new role in World of Warcraft. It used to be only level 80 players that would enter low level instances to collect items that they could sell on the auction house. Nowadays, people can enter the instance for their current level and still earn gold.

When you have an Enchanter in your party, you can now roll Disenchant instead of Greed or Need. Charming materials are always in demand at the auction house. This will bring you a lot of gold. You now make gold and power level up to 80 through dungeon leveling. All thanks to the dungeon finder.
